How accurate is 5-HIAA urine test?

How accurate is 5-HIAA urine test?

However, fasting plasma 5-HIAA assay showed greater stability than whole blood serotonin assay and is more convenient for the patient than a 24-h urine collection. At a cut-off value of 118 nmol/L plasma 5-HIAA assay showed a sensitivity of 89%, a specificity of 97% and a test efficiency of 93%.

What does a high level of 5-HIAA mean?

Elevated levels of 5-HIAA suggest a neuroendocrine tumor is present. You will be advised to avoid foods like bananas, walnuts, pineapple, tomatoes, eggplant, kiwi fruit and plums before taking this test since these foods contain serotonin.

What is the 24 hour urine collection procedure?

A 24-hour urine collection is done by collecting your urine in a special container over a full 24-hour period. The container must be kept cool until the urine is returned to the lab. Urine is made up of water and dissolved chemicals, such as sodium and potassium.

Is it normal to pee blood with an uti?

It’s “normal for a UTI to cause bloody urine. It happens because the infection-causing bacteria in your urinary tract cause inflammation and irritation to your cells there. Your urine may look pink, red, or cola-colored. If you have bleeding from a UTI, or if you have other UTI symptoms, see your doctor.

What is the CPT code for 24 hour urine?

24-hour urine specimen collection is reported using the following CPT code: 81050 VOLUME MEASUREMENT for timed collection, each This code should be used whenever a volumetric measure of urine is required to report a test result.
